The global Spinning Disk Confocal Microscopy (SDCM) market size was US$ 127 million in 2024 and is forecast to a readjusted size of US$ 260 million by 2031 with a CAGR of 11.0% during the forecast period 2025-2031.

Spinning Disk Confocal Microscopy (SDCM) is an advanced optical imaging technique that enhances the clarity and resolution of fluorescent imaging. It employs a disk with multiple pinholes that rotate at high speed to scan and capture fluorescence from the specimen. This method allows for the acquisition of high-resolution, real-time images with reduced photobleaching and phototoxicity compared to traditional single-point laser scanning confocal microscopy. Spinning disk confocal microscopy is most often used for live-cell samples, as less damage is done to the sample through photobleaching and so changes in the sample can be viewed over time.
Spinning disk confocal microscopy overcomes several weaknesses of conventional fluorescence microscopy, including removing out of focus light and using optical sectioning to construct 3-dimensional models from 2- dimensional image slices.
Researchers are increasingly looking to combine SDCM with super-resolution microscopy techniques like STORM (Stochastic Optical Reconstruction Microscopy) or PALM (Photoactivated Localization Microscopy). This integration allows for higher resolution imaging while maintaining the speed and reduced photodamage benefits of SDCM.
The spinning disk confocal microscopy industry has high technology barrier and dominated by a few suppliers. There are more expected new entrants in the future due to promising demand, which will lead to intensified competition.
The spinning disk confocal microscopy industry has high technology barrier. Globally, key suppliers of spinning disk confocal microscopy include Evident, Nikon, Oxford Instruments Andor. In addition, due to the operation complexity of the system, skilled persons are needed, which limits the usage of spinning disk confocal microscopy as well.
There is growing interest in real-time live-cell imaging, driven by advances in biological research, particularly in fields like cancer research, neuroscience, and developmental biology. Spinning disk confocal microscopy is favored due to its ability to provide fast imaging with low phototoxicity, making it ideal for observing live cells over extended periods.With the fast development of related industries, such as cell biology, demand of spinning disk confocal microscopy will continue to increase with promising market potential.
